Deburring robots are industrial robotic systems designed to automate the removal of burrs, sharp edges, and imperfections from machined metal, plastic, or composite parts. Unlike manual deburring (which is slow, inconsistent, and labor-intensive), robotic deburring delivers high precision, repeatability, and efficiency—making it essential for industries like automotive, aerospace, medical devices, and metal fabrication.

A deburring robot is an industrial robotic system equipped with specialized tools (grinding wheels, brushes, or cutting tools) to remove burrs, sharp edges, and excess material from machined components. Unlike manual deburring, which is time-consuming and inconsistent, robotic deburring ensures high precision, repeatability, and speed, making it ideal for high-volume production environments.
Automated Burr Removal
Uses force-controlled tools to adapt to part variations.
Handles complex geometries (holes, edges, contours) with precision.
Multi-Axis Flexibility
6-axis robotic arms for full 3D deburring capabilities.
Can be integrated with CNC machines or conveyor systems for inline processing.
Adaptive Tooling Options
Rotary brushes, abrasive belts, spindle grinders, or laser deburring.
Automatic tool changers for different finishing requirements.
Vision & AI-Guided Systems (Optional)
Machine vision for part recognition and path correction.
AI-based adaptive control for varying material hardness.
Seamless Integration with Production Lines
Compatible with PLC, CNC, and MES systems for Industry 4.0 smart factories.
